|  | /* | 
|  | * LED driver for Richtek RT8515 flash/torch white LEDs | 
|  | * found on some Samsung mobile phones.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* This is a 1.5A Boost dual channel driver produced around 2011.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* The component lacks a datasheet, but in the schematic picture | 
|  | * from the LG P970 service manual you can see the connections | 
|  | * from the RT8515 to the LED, with two resistors connected | 
|  | * from the pins "RFS" and "RTS" to ground.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* On the LG P970: | 
|  | * RFS (resistance flash setting?) is 20 kOhm | 
|  | * RTS (resistance torch setting?) is 39 kOhm | 
|  | * | 
|  | * Some sleuthing finds us the RT9387A which we have a datasheet for: | 
|  | * https://static5.arrow.com/pdfs/2014/7/27/8/21/12/794/rtt_/manual/94download_ds.jspprt9387a.jspprt9387a.pdf | 
|  | * This apparently works the same way so in theory this driver | 
|  | * should cover RT9387A as well. This has not been tested, please | 
|  | * update the compatibles if you add RT9387A support.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* Linus Walleij <linus.walleij@linaro.org> | 
|  | */ |

|  | /* We can provide 15-700 mA out to the LED */ | 
|  | #define RT8515_MIN_IOUT_MA	15 | 
|  | #define RT8515_MAX_IOUT_MA	700 | 
|  | /* The maximum intensity is 1-16 for flash and 1-100 for torch */ | 
|  | #define RT8515_FLASH_MAX	16 | 
|  | #define RT8515_TORCH_MAX	100 | 
|  |  | 
|  | #define RT8515_TIMEOUT_US	250000U | 
|  | #define RT8515_MAX_TIMEOUT_US	300000U |

|  | static void rt8515_gpio_brightness_commit(struct gpio_desc *gpiod, | 
|  | int brightness) | 
|  | { | 
|  | int i;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Toggling a GPIO line with a small delay increases the | 
|  | * brightness one step at a time.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| for (i = 0; i < brightness; i++) { | 
|  | gpiod_set_value(gpiod, 0); | 
|  | udelay(1); | 
|  | gpiod_set_value(gpiod, 1); | 
|  | udelay(1); | 
|  | } |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* This is setting the torch light level */ | 
|  | static int rt8515_led_brightness_set(struct led_classdev *led, | 
|  | enum led_brightness brightness) | 
|  | { | 
|  | struct led_classdev_flash *fled = lcdev_to_flcdev(led); | 
|  | struct rt8515 *rt = to_rt8515(fled); | 
|  |  | 
|  | mutex_lock(&rt->lock); |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(brightness == LED_OFF) { | 
|  | /* Off */ | 
|  | rt8515_gpio_led_off(rt); | 
|  | } else if (brightness < RT8515_TORCH_MAX) { | 
|  | /* Step it up to movie mode brightness using the flash pin */ | 
|  | rt8515_gpio_brightness_commit(rt->enable_torch, brightness); | 
|  | } else { | 
|  | /* Max torch brightness requested */ | 
|  | gpiod_set_value(rt->enable_torch, 1);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| mutex_unlock(&rt->lock); | 
|  |  |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} |

|  | static void rt8515_determine_max_intensity(struct rt8515 *rt, | 
|  | struct fwnode_handle *led, | 
|  | const char *resistance, | 
|  | const char *max_ua_prop, int hw_max, | 
|  | int *max_intensity_setting) | 
|  | { | 
|  | u32 res = 0; /* Can't be 0 so 0 is undefined */ | 
|  | u32 ua; | 
|  | u32 max_ma; | 
|  | int max_intensity; | 
|  | int ret; | 
|  |  | 
|  | fwnode_property_read_u32(rt->dev->fwnode, resistance, &res); | 
|  | ret = fwnode_property_read_u32(led, max_ua_prop, &ua); |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* Missing info in DT, OK go with hardware maxima */ | 
|  | if (ret || res == 0) { | 
|  | dev_err(rt->dev, | 
|  | "either %s or %s missing from DT, using HW max\n", | 
|  | resistance, max_ua_prop); | 
|  | max_ma = RT8515_MAX_IOUT_MA; | 
|  | max_intensity = hw_max; | 
|  | goto out_assign_max;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Formula from the datasheet, this is the maximum current | 
|  | * defined by the hardware.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| max_ma = (5500 * 1000) / res; |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Calculate max intensity (linear scaling) | 
|  | * Formula is ((ua / 1000) / max_ma) * 100, then simplified | 
|  | */ | 
|  | max_intensity = (ua / 10) / max_ma; | 
|  |  | 
|  | dev_info(rt->dev, | 
|  | "current restricted from %u to %u mA, max intensity %d/100\n", | 
|  | max_ma, (ua / 1000), max_intensity); | 
|  |  | 
|  | out_assign_max: | 
|  | dev_info(rt->dev, "max intensity %d/%d = %d mA\n", | 
|  | max_intensity, hw_max, max_ma); | 
|  | *max_intensity_setting = max_intensity; | 
|  | } |
